Bulgur is a high-demand whole grain product made from premium-quality wheat that has been cleaned, parboiled, dried, and cracked into uniform granules. With rising global demand for healthy and convenient food ingredients, Indian Bulgur is becoming increasingly popular across international markets due to its nutritional richness, quick cooking time, and versatility in food processing.
Produced in advanced milling and processing units, export-grade Bulgur undergoes strict cleaning, sorting, and granulation procedures to ensure consistent size, low moisture, and optimal shelf life. Its high fiber content, rich mineral profile, and whole-grain characteristics make it ideal for manufacturers of ready meals, Mediterranean foods, healthy snacks, bakery blends, and plant-based meal kits.

Available in multiple granulation grades (fine, medium, coarse)
Fine Bulgur (ideal for bakery blends, porridges, snacks)
Medium Bulgur (commonly used in salads, pilafs, ready meals)
Coarse Bulgur (for traditional cooking and foodservice use)
Mediterranean and Middle Eastern foods (tabbouleh, kibbeh, pilaf)
Ready-to-eat and ready-to-cook packaged meals
Healthy cereals and multigrain blends
Soups, bakery recipes, and nutritional mixes
Vegan meal kits and plant-based food industries
Indian Bulgur is typically exported in 25 kg, 40 kg, 50 kg bags and retail-ready private-label pouches, depending on buyer requirements. Each batch is tested for purity, granulation consistency, and moisture stability to ensure compliance with international food safety regulations.
